    More information about Carl Hiaasen 'Stormy Weather' Book

    treasure the thrilling novel 'Stormy Weather' by Carl Hiaasen. A captivating read.
    Dive into the wildly comic world of "Stormy Weather" by Carl Hiaasen, a masterful blend of humor and suspense that promises to keep readers on the edge of their seats. This paperback edition, published by Grand Central Publishing in 2018, showcases Hiaasen's satirical prowess as he weaves a tale filled with twists and turns amidst the backdrop of a stormy Florida Keys.

    The novel spans 464 pages of engaging narrative, featuring an ensemble of quirky characters and unexpected plot twists. Measuring 7.6 by 4.2 inches with a depth of 1.2 inches, this mass market edition is faultless for readers on the go. With its ISBN 9781538729571 and Dewey classification FIC, this book is a must-have for enthusiasts of mystery, detective stories, and Black Humor genres.
